This Iconic Horror House Is Up Sale


Nightmare on Elm Street followers has an opportunity to get the home that made the franchise well-known.
The unique movie, A Nightmare on Elm Road, launched in 1984, follows Freddy Kruger (Robert Englund), a serial killer’s spirit that preys on youngsters whereas they’re sleeping and in the end kills them, which then turns into a actuality. The horror basic additionally served as Johnny Depp’s debut function.
The property, listed under, is situated at 1428 North Genesee Avenue in Los Angeles, California, was a set location for the franchise’s first movie. Within the film, the house was fictionally based mostly on Elm Road in Springwood, Ohio.
According to Deadline, the residence available on the market for $3.25 million is a Dutch colonial-style house with three bedrooms and 4 loos. It additionally consists of walnut flooring, a modernized kitchen, a separate laundry room, and different important objects, particularly for individuals who work remotely.
Along with the listed options, the property has a indifferent guesthouse. The guesthouse comes with a patio, a kitchen, and an eccentric lavatory.
Again in 2013, the house was bought by Hustlers director Lorene Scafaria for $2.1 million. No further particulars about why Scafaria listed the property up on the market have been launched to the general public.
